### Escalation — Nightfill scheduler

If Nightfill misses its 02:00 kickoff, first check whether the lock from the previous backfill cleared — nine times out of ten it's a stuck lease. Clear it and rerun; downstream reports tolerate up to a four-hour delay. If jobs fail twice in a row or the queue depth keeps climbing past 500, stop retrying. That's your cue to escalate to the batch platform folks, who can be reached here.

escalation mailbox, bafog-fafog: ulador@paliqlabs.internal

Subject: Handover — image cache leak

Taking over from me: the Glintbox image cache leaks ~40 MB/hour under plugin load. Cause looks like plugins holding decoded bitmaps past eviction. Until the API is fixed, plugin authors should release handles explicitly — docs updated. Leak metrics are sampled every 5 min into the diagnostics table. Restart the cache daemon weekly as a stopgap. Check growth trends yourself against the diagnostics database using the connection string below.

primary connection of yagep-kahip = redis://giliel_svc:zYiKsLL2PLpfPL@db-348f.xolmarsys.corp:5432/fenwyn

Handover Note — Warranty Costs, Dravern Appliances

To my successor: the Calyx dryer line has run 38% over warranty budget for two consecutive quarters, driven by a drum-bearing defect in units built at the Norwick plant. A supplier claim is in progress and a design fix ships next month. Reserve adequacy needs your early attention. The board's intended response is noted confidentially below.

confidential, kahog-tahag: The renewal with Holixax Holdings closes at $5 million a year, 20 percent below the last contract. Project Ulaael slips by one quarter because of the supplier delay.

Subject: Vexaprof 3.1 cut

Team — Vexaprof 3.1 is tagged. Fixes the double-free in the CUDA snapshot path and adds per-stream memory deltas. Contractors: use this build only; 3.0 misreports pinned allocations. Staging rollout starts Thursday, prod Monday. Report anomalies in the Harkness channel. The build token for this release is below.

session token of tajog-fahaf = htk21_4ae55819f45410afcb307